Design of Experiments Applied to Aerodynamic Simulation of a Sub-Compact Vehicle

2004-11-16
2004-01-3250
The use of DoE (Design of Experiments) is an established practice in aerodynamic wind tunnel testing. DoE generates efficient test plans that gather useful information about the influence of design factors on aerodynamic performance, while reducing test time. The same approach has been applied to CFD simulation. A fractional factorial design was used to investigate the impact of some design factors on drag. The results are used to determine a response function, which in turn allows the effect of any combination of factors to be assessed without the need for further simulation runs.

Use of CFD to Support Heat Management CAE Simulation

2003-11-18
2003-01-3559
Heat protection CAE calculations currently use convection coefficients estimated with base on experience with previous designs. A CFD model was used to predict local convection coefficients, in an attempt to achieve more accurate results. Results obtained with the estimated and calculated coefficients are compared with field data.
